What is Napkin?

Napkin AI converts pasted or imported text into visual formats such as infographics, diagrams, mind maps, flowcharts, and data charts. Users can choose from generated options, edit colors and individual elements, apply branding, and export visuals for presentations, documents, blogs, and social media.

What are the pros and cons of Napkin?

Strengths

Generates several visual interpretations directly from written text
Supports many common diagram and infographic formats
Lets users edit generated visuals instead of accepting a fixed output
Offers broad file import and PNG and PDF export on the free plan
Includes brand styles, custom branding, and font uploads on paid plans

Trade-offs

AI generation is limited by credits, with usage based roughly on the number of selected words
Free visuals include Napkin branding
PPT and SVG export require a paid plan
Customization depth is limited compared with detailed graphic design tools
The product is focused on diagrams and visual content rather than detailed data analysis or non-diagram design

What are Napkin’s key features?

Generates visuals from pasted or imported text without prompt writing
Creates infographics, diagrams, mind maps, flowcharts, and data charts
Allows users to edit colors and reshape individual visual elements
Imports PPT, DOC, PDF, HTML, and MD files
Exports visuals as PNG, PDF, PPT, and SVG, with some formats limited to paid plans
Supports brand styles, custom branding, and font uploads on paid plans

What is the pricing for Napkin?

PlanPriceDetails
Free$0500 AI credits per week, unlimited visual editing, file import, and PNG and PDF export, with Napkin branding.
Plus$9 per person / monthIncludes Free features, 10,000 AI credits per month, PPT and SVG export, three brand styles, branding removal, and team management.
Pro$22 per person / monthIncludes Plus features, 30,000 AI credits per month, exclusive designs, unlimited custom branding, font uploads, and optional credit top-ups.

Annual billing saves 25% compared with monthly billing. Enterprise plans require contacting Napkin. AI credits are charged at approximately one credit per selected word, though this may change for more complex outputs or advanced features.

Who is Napkin best for?

presentersA strong fit for turning written ideas into presentation-ready diagrams and visuals.
educatorsUseful for creating visual explanations, teaching materials, and classroom content from text.
designersWorks well for quickly developing editable visual concepts, though it does not replace a detailed graphic design tool.
small teamPaid plans support shared billing, team management, and brand controls for teams producing visual content regularly.
Not for
  • Buyers who need detailed graphic design controls or non-diagram visual creation should use a broader design tool.
  • Teams focused on detailed data analysis should look beyond Napkin's visual-generation workflow.
  • Users who need high-volume generation may find the monthly AI credit limits restrictive.
